Output 34d4cd5a3419eabc689a880e7ddb9502f80297a591bad0e151cd4c0a7ebcf026:16

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ea23804bbfc4b8d9ccd095d621682c2be65f402fd1fe71ed4aec92d848a14d3
address
tb1pd63rsp9ml39cm8xdp9wky95zc2lxtaqzl507w8k54myjmpy2znfs96s0ad
transaction
34d4cd5a3419eabc689a880e7ddb9502f80297a591bad0e151cd4c0a7ebcf026
spent
true